However, every design has its limitations, and a professional evaluation must acknowledge them. You should use this asset carefully if your brand requires a very formal corporate identity. The organic nature of the flowers might clash with a strict, minimalist aesthetic common in luxury tech or high-end finance sectors. Additionally, if you are designing for extremely small labels, the intricate details of the illustration might become muddy or indistinguishable. In crowded product packaging with heavy legal information, the graphic could compete with essential text, reducing readability. In these cases, it is better to use the design as a subtle border or a faint watermark rather than a focal point.

Essential Designer Notes for Implementation

Before integrating Spring Flowers Card Design into your commercial design projects, there are several practical steps every brand owner should take. First, test the asset on real packaging mockups. Seeing the design on a 3D render or a physical prototype reveals how the colors interact with the material of the box or bottle. Always check the black and white usage to ensure the design retains its impact when printed in monochrome, which is common for cost-effective printing options. Previewing the graphic on small labels is critical to ensure the fine lines do not disappear during production.

Technical compatibility is another vital factor. Since you will receive this design in formats like AI File and SVG File, you have the advantage of vector editability. This means you can resize the image without losing quality, a crucial feature for everything from a business card to a large billboard. Inspect the SVG or vector editability to see if you can adjust the colors to match your specific brand palette. Compare the design with competitor packaging to ensure it offers a unique twist rather than blending in. If you plan to use it alongside typography, test it beside serif fonts for a classic look, sans-serif fonts for a modern feel, or script and handwritten fonts for a personal touch.
